Team Carysil Suhana Clinches Jaipur Open Polo Title in Nail-Biting Final

In a fiercely contested championship match at the Rajasthan Polo Club Ground in Jaipur on Saturday, Team Carysil Suhana secured a narrow 12-10 victory over Team Vimal Arion Achievers. The triumph earned them the prestigious Jaipur Open for Brig HH Maharaja Sawai Bhawani Singh, MVC Cup, a 14-goal tournament that showcased elite polo talent.

Star Performers Lead Carysil Suhana to Victory

The winning side was propelled by an outstanding performance from Matias Vial, who dominated the field with a remarkable 7 goals. Manuel Prado contributed significantly with 4 goals, while Bhawani Singh Kalvi added a crucial goal to the tally. The team also featured Ashok Chandna, whose efforts supported the overall strategy.

Vimal Arion Achievers Put Up a Valiant Fight

Despite the loss, Team Vimal Arion Achievers displayed tenacity, with Dhruvpal Godara matching Vial's intensity by scoring 7 goals. Alejo Aramburu netted 2 goals, and Daniel Otamendi added 1 goal to their score. However, Salim Azmi struggled to make an impact in the high-stakes encounter.

Awards and Recognition

Manuel Prado was honored as the Most Valuable Player for his pivotal role in the championship win. The trophy presentation was a grand affair, with dignitaries including Chirag Parekh, Reha Parekh Jain, Padmanabh Singh, Narendra Singh, Digvijay Singh, and Vikramaditya Singh Barkana officiating the ceremony.

Upcoming Event: PDKF Ladies Polo Cup

Polo enthusiasts can look forward to the prestigious Princess Diya Kumari Foundation (PDKF) Ladies Polo Cup, scheduled for Sunday, February 22. The event will commence at 4:30 PM at the Rajasthan Polo Club Ground. Deputy Chief Minister of Rajasthan, Diya Kumari, will grace the occasion as the chief guest, adding to the event's significance.
